About No Dress Code
No Dress Code is our annual informal scratch night offering local artists the opportunity to test work-in-progress in front of a live audience. No Dress Code 2025 takes place at Yorkshire Dance on Friday 21 November in the evening. The event normally features 3 or 4 works-in-progress.
After the performances we display your questions and invite the audience to provide written feedback and share their insights. There are also plenty of opportunities to discuss your work in person with local artists and audiences throughout the evening.
Each dance artist selected to perform receives a fee of £135 and studio space during the week of No Dress Code (if required and available).
We are looking for:
- Works-in-progress. i.e. New work in early phase of research and development.
- Performance, film or installation work created for a live audience.
- Work suitable to programme in a studio or performance space.
- Short pieces (5-15 minutes duration), with little or no previous audience exposure. Or an excerpt from a longer work still in development.
- Work with minimal technical requirements due to quick turnarounds between performances.
- Work with minimal set-up of props/set/equipment.
- Works created by artists or companies based in the North of England.
Selection Process:
We only consider proposals from artists who are not in full-time education and work in the North of England.
Our selection process considers the strength of the artistic idea, our budget and the technical and logistical feasibility of programming the work within No Dress Code.
We aim to inform successful applicants by Tuesday 1 July 2025 allowing time for selected applicants to include No Dress Code as a public testing event within funding applications.
